Frequently asked questions

Is this instrument designed for specific spinal procedures?

Yes, this curette is specifically engineered for cervical and lumbar surgical environments. Its specialized bayonet curvature is optimized to provide surgeons with precise access and maneuverability during delicate spinal procedures.

What is the significance of the 0000 sizing?

The 0000 sizing indicates a highly precise, fine-dimension tip configuration. This is essential for surgeons who require meticulous control and delicate tissue manipulation in confined surgical fields.

Is the bayonet design helpful for visualization?

Absolutely. The bayonet-style offset is a critical design feature that shifts the instrument’s shaft away from the line of sight. This configuration significantly improves the surgeon’s view of the operative field while maintaining the necessary reach.

How does the forward angle tip assist the surgeon?

The forward angle tip is configured to reach areas that are otherwise difficult to access with a straight instrument. This allows for more ergonomic positioning and improved leverage when performing detailed work within the cervical and lumbar regions.

What is the total length of the instrument?

The instrument has an overall length of 9½ inches, providing an ideal balance between reach and tactical control for deep-tissue procedures.
